Baibhav Kumar
Learn and master data structures and algorithms interview questions with detailed explanations, Python code, and complexity analysis. Ideal for students, beginners, and developers preparing for coding interviews.
Master the Core of Data Structures and Algorithms with 150+ Interview Questions and Answers with example
Crack technical interviews with confidence using this practical and student-friendly guide to Data Structures and Algorithms (DSA). Data Structures & Algorithms Interview Q&A is designed for college students, beginners, and aspiring software developers who want to strengthen their understanding of core programming concepts and excel in coding interviews.
This book provides step-by-step solutions, Python-based code examples, and complexity analysis for all essential DSA topics, including arrays, linked lists, stacks, queues, trees, heaps, graphs, and recursion. Each question is structured like a real interview challenge: learn the concept, understand the logic, explore the code, and analyze the time-space efficiency.
150+ interview-oriented questions with detailed explanations.
Covers all major topics — Arrays, Linked Lists, Trees, Graphs, and Sorting Algorithms.
Python code snippets for easy implementation and practice.
Complexity tables for a clear understanding of efficiency.
Real-world analogies that connect theory with practice.
Perfect for campus placements, technical assessments, and software job interviews.
Builds a strong foundation in both theory and application.
Explains DSA concepts in simple, beginner-friendly language.
Designed for global readers, clear English and universal examples.
Ideal for students, developers, and interview aspirants worldwide.
If you’re preparing for coding rounds, technical interviews, or simply want to master the logic behind problem-solving, this book is your structured path from basics to advanced problem-solving.
Unlock unlimited ebook downloads. Share it on your social profile.